About the Book



"After a tragic miscarriage and a year spent locked in an asylum, Clara Blackstone travels north to meet her husband Henry for a fresh start, but she's haunted by foggy memories of the past year and a growing distrust of her husband for committing her. After a tense reunion, their carriage runs into a mob surrounding mass murderer Mary Ann Cotton as she's brought to Durham Jail to await trial. When Clara learns that Cotton is not only pregnant but accused of murdering her own children and stepchildren, she begins to visit her regularly in prison, trying to reconcile Cotton's own account of her actions with the shocking allegations against her in sensational newspaper accounts that scandalize the male-dominated Victorian society. As their relationship intensifies, Clara begins to reinvent herself as she fights against her increasingly controlling husband for her own sanity, her freedom, and the truth about her past."--Provided by publisher.



Book Synopsis



"A fascinating portrayal of womanhood in Victorian England that is also a nail-biting thriller that will keep readers riveted until the very last page." --Booklist

Perfect for fans of Margaret Atwood's Alias Grace and Hannah Kent's Burial Rites, this taut psychological thriller offers a delicious take on deviant and defiant Victorian women in a time when marriage itself was its own prison.

England, 1873. Clara Blackstone has just been released after one year in a private asylum for the insane. Clara has two goals: to reunite with her husband, Henry, and to never--ever--return to the asylum. As she enters Durham, Clara finds her carriage surrounded by a mob gathered to witness the imprisonment of Mary Ann Cotton--England's first female serial killer--accused of poisoning nearly twenty people, including her husbands and children.

Clara soon finds the oppressive confinement of her marriage no less terrifying than the white-tiled walls of Hoxton. And as she grows increasingly suspicious of Henry's intentions, her fascination with Cotton grows. Soon, Cotton is not just a notorious figure from the headlines, but an unlikely confidante, mentor--and perhaps accomplice--in Clara's struggle to protect her money, her freedom and her life.
